Position Summary

The Propellant Distribution System (PDS) Quality Engineer is responsible for ensuring quality performance across all IRAD and production activities for PDS hardware. This role serves as the subject‑matter expert (SME) for the PDS line replaceable unit (LRU), supporting both program execution and internal quality initiatives. The position partners closely with program quality engineers, engineering, and manufacturing teams to drive effective nonconformance management, corrective actions, and continuous improvement for PDS products.

This role is based in Littleton, Colorado.

Essential Functions
  • Serve as the quality subject‑matter expert (SME) for PDS line replaceable units across IRAD and production efforts.
  • Manage and monitor nonconformances and corrective actions (CAPAs) to ensure timely resolution and product compliance.
  • Own nonconformance (NC) processes for PDS products, including documentation, disposition support, and closure activities.
  • Lead and support root cause investigations to identify systemic issues and drive effective corrective actions.
  • Partner with contract and program quality engineers to support program‑specific nonconformances and quality requirements.
  • Collaborate with cross‑functional teams to ensure alignment on quality expectations, product requirements, and issue resolution.
  • Analyze quality data and trends to identify risk areas and support continuous improvement initiatives.
  • Ensure compliance with AS9100 requirements, internal procedures, and contractual obligations.
Basic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ree in engineering or related discipline with 5+ years of experience in quality engineering, manufacturing quality, or aerospace quality systems.
  • Experience managing nonconformances and corrective action processes in a regulated or manufacturing environment.
  • Demonstrated ability to lead or support root cause investigations and implement corrective actions.
  • Experience working with cross‑functional teams in a production and/or engineering environment.
  • Strong understanding of quality management system principles (e.g., AS9100 or equivalent).
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.
  • Candidates must be able to comply with the federally mandated requirements of U.S. export control and ITAR compliance laws, which require proof that the candidate is a U.S. person.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Understanding of fluidic engineering.
  • Prior experience supporting aerospace or highly regulated manufacturing environments.
  • Demonstrated ability to act as a product line SME or technical quality lead.
